Weather in May

The last month of the spring, May, is an enjoyable month in Saint Olaf, Iowa, with an average temperature ranging between min 49.3°F (9.6°C) and max 66.7°F (19.3°C).

Temperature

With the onset of May, Saint Olaf experiences a temperature shift, with the average high-temperature moving from a fresh 54.5°F (12.5°C) in April to an enjoyable 66.7°F (19.3°C). The average low-temperature of 49.3°F (9.6°C) is witnessed in Saint Olaf during May.

Humidity

In Saint Olaf, the average relative humidity in May is 81%.

Rainfall

In Saint Olaf, Iowa, in May, it is raining for 19.3 days, with typically 4.13" (105mm) of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 138 rainfall days, and 29.21" (742m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through May, October through December are months with snowfall. May is the last month it regularly snows. During 0.2 snowfall days, in May, Saint Olaf aggregates 0.08" (2mm) of snow. In Saint Olaf, during the entire year, snow falls for 48.5 days and aggregates up to 19.76" (502mm) of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in May is 14h and 40min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 5:58 am and sunset at 8:06 pm. On the last day of May, in Saint Olaf, sunrise is at 5:29 am and sunset at 8:37 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In May, the average sunshine is 8.3h.

UV index

May through August, with an average maximum UV index of 5, are months with the highest UV index in Saint Olaf. A UV Index value of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: The daily high UV index of 5 in May translates into this advice:
Preventative actions are necessary - Suggestions to safeguard against sun damage are in order. The Sun's most intense and consequently most harmful UV radiation during midday hours should be decreased by minimizing exposure and seeking shade. Using UVA and UVB-protective sunglasses and sun-protective clothing is effective against UV radiation. Attention! Nearly twice the Sun's UV radiation can be reflected by snow.
